MENDOZA-CIFUENTES, Humberto. Taxonomic review of the genus Meriania (Melastomataceae) in Colombia. Act. Bot. Mex [online]. 2021, n.128, e1734.  Epub May 30, 2021. ISSN 2448-7589.  https://doi.org/10.21829/abm128.2021.1734.

Background and Aims:

The genus Meriania has 120 neotropical species, 51 of them in Colombia. This work deals with the taxonomic review of the genus for Colombia, documenting species, subspecies, and synonyms.

Methods:

A total of 660 specimens of Meriania from 24 herbaria from Colombia, Ecuador, the United States of America, and England were reviewed and evaluated, and the protologues and images of type specimens in JSTOR Global Plants of the species present in Colombia were consulted. A detailed description of the genus, an identification key, as well as descriptions, illustrations, distribution maps and threat categories are established for each of the species present in Colombia.

Key results:

Meriania is characterized by petals ≥9 mm long, nongeniculate stamens, anthers of antepetalous stamens with dorsally inclined pores, capsular fruits and seeds with a straight embryo. Two new species (M. neilli and M. ramosii) and three new subspecies of M. macrophylla (M. macrophylla subsp. antioquiensis, M. macrophylla subsp. franciscana and M. macrophylla subsp. peltata) are described. In addition, 18 new synonyms are established and 19 lectotypifications are carried out. The species in Colombia are distributed in the Andean region (34 spp.), Sierra Nevada de Santa Marta (2 spp.), and Guiana Shield-Orinoquia (2 spp.), between 100 and 3700 m a.s.l. Threat categories are documented for 31 species, while six species were not categorized because most of their distribution ranges are found in other countries.

Conclusions:

With this revision, Meriania consists of 102 species, 37 of them present in Colombia. Andean species (33 spp.) can be considered within Meriania s.s., while four species found in lowland areas of the Magdalena Medio and Guiana Shield-Orinoquia could be considered as different genera in the future, based on anthers characters, ovary locule number, and seminal rudiment arrangement.
